InfoWARE Asset Management Brochure Mockup
InfoWARE Limited is a software company with over 2 decades of experience in building software to manage stock portfolio and assets.
More by Charles Esumeh View profile
Like
InfoWARE Limited is a software company with over 2 decades of experience in building software to manage stock portfolio and assets.